It is a world of betrayals and alliances, of spells and magic, of haunting dreams and dark desires... The rebel princess Alexeika is captured and tortured by the evil Grethori—but is sustained by dreams of the man who will set her free... Prince Gavril yearns to control the dark magick of a cursed sword—while his desperate betrothed pursues another man's heart... Asked to help protect Gavril, the half-elven Dain continues a quest to fulfill his adoptive father's dying wish... It is a journey that will give him the chance to save the woman he loves—and will place him at odds with the destiny that he and Alexeika share. A destiny that can only be realized with the help of a long-lost talisman...
Author

The internationally published, award-winning author of 41 novels, Deborah Chester has written Regency romances, historical romances, young adult, science fiction, and fantasy. She is a tenured professor of professional writing in the Gaylord College of Journalism and Mass Communication at the University of Oklahoma, where she teaches novel and short story writing. She holds a B.A. with General Honors and an M.A. in Journalism; both degrees are from the University of Oklahoma, where she studied professional writing from author/teachers Jack M. Bickham, Robert L. Duncan, and Pulitzer-nominee Carolyn Hart. Chester has been writing professionally since 1978, and has used three pseudonyms – Jay D. Blakeney and Sean Dalton and C. Aubrey Hall for some of her science fiction and fantasy works. In 2004, she was inducted into the Writers Hall of Fame of America.
